  3. Slightly off-topic but still about the car... How much would an exhaust mod like that cost?

    remus quad exhaust is around $1000USD

    So you convert that to NZD, add shipping to NZ, add taxes on the goods + shipping, gst, customs duty etc

    Probably be looking at around $2500 NZD

    Then you also need a bumper change or if you want a cheap crap job, cut a hole in the right side of the bumper to fit the exhaust

    But if you want the new bumper probably another $200+ at least on top

    so yea not the cheapest
